The AI is nearly nonexistent, instead relying on basic location triggers and a few rote tactics. One consists of standing in the middle of the room and shooting at you. The other consists of crouching behind an obstacle for a few seconds, then standing up and shooting at you. Your tactics will almost never require nothing more than walking up to the trigger point, then backing away and picking them off at medium to long range.

Each map is strewn with glowing circles that signify a place where your character (Marcus or Mike, the game swaps each guy arbitrarily as you progress) can stand beside a door and "lean" around, which he can't do automatically. The circles can be handy if you want to find cover quickly, as hitting the space bar when you're close enough will tell the guy to do a duck and roll or sprint. But as the AI is so dumb, you'll almost never need this. And since "leaning" isn't actually leaning, but swiveling around to stand in the middle of the doorway, the circles aren't very useful at all. But they are almost always the trigger points. So, find circle, get close to it, hit space bar, and back up to a spot where you can actually avoid the bullets. Wash, rinse, repeat.

This is a bad thing because the enemies already spawned in the room are physically tuned to which door you'll be bursting through and will be pumping leg before you've gotten your bearings. This is particularly painful when there's someone right on the other side of the door with a shotgun, because you can't start firing until you've agonizingly completed the "kicking through the door" animation. This is also particularly painful because of all the closed doors between you and the end of the game, and because you can only (1) kick them open or (2) open from the side with a circle trigger and dash for a safe spot. Every time you "lean" out from the side, you'll have several dudes plugging you. Enemies will also magically trigger from spawn points you knew were completely empty only moments before.

The pain doesn't end there, though. BB2 uses a rather conservative save game method, only bookmarking your progress once, at the beginning of a stage. I can deal with at least progressive auto-saves, or some kind of save game object you have to find. But when the game is already little better than a way to kill time, there's not much joy to be found in repeating the same ten to fifteen minutes you just played through if you die during the boss fight at the tail end. At least save it right before I have to fight the stage boss.
